思潮课程 / 前端开发 / 正文

vue的效果,现代前端开发的强壮结构

2024-12-30前端开发 阅读 6

Vue.js 是一个用于构建用户界面的开源 JavaScript 结构,由尤雨溪于 2014 年创立,现在现已被广泛运用于各类 Web 开发项目中。Vue 的首要效果和优势包含:

1. 声明式烘托:Vue 答应开发者运用简练的模板语法来声明式地描绘终究输出的 HTML,让开发者能够愈加专心于数据的逻辑处理,而不是直接操作 DOM。

2. 组件化:Vue 支撑组件化开发,能够将界面分割成独立、可复用的组件,每个组件都有自己的状况和办法,便于保护和复用。

3. 呼应式体系:Vue 的中心库只重视视图层,易于与第三方库或既有项目集成。Vue 的呼应式体系保证当数据发生变化时,视图也会相应地更新。

4. 灵敏的API规划:Vue 供给了灵敏的 API 规划,既能够渐进式地引进到现有项目中,也能够作为完好的结构来构建大型运用。

5. 双向数据绑定:Vue 完成了数据与视图的双向绑定,即当数据发生变化时,视图会主动更新,反之亦然。

6. 生态体系丰厚:Vue 有一个巨大的生态体系,包含官方的 Vue Router(路由办理)、Vuex(状况办理)、Vue CLI(项目脚手架)等,还有很多的第三方库和东西,能够满意各种开发需求。

7. 社区支撑:Vue 具有一个活泼和友爱的社区,开发者能够从中取得协助、共享经历和学习最佳实践。

8. 跨渠道才能:经过 Weex 和 uniapp 等技能,Vue 能够扩展到移动端、桌面端乃至更多渠道。

Vue 的规划哲学是简练、高效、灵敏,它易于上手,一起也能应对杂乱的运用场景。关于开发者来说,运用 Vue 能够大大进步开发功率和代码质量,是现代 Web 开发中十分受欢迎的挑选之一。

Vue.js:现代前端开发的强壮结构

Vue.js是由尤雨溪(Evan You)于2014年创立的一个渐进式JavaScript结构。它答应开发者运用简练的模板语法来构建用户界面,一起将逻辑与视图别离,使得代码愈加明晰、易于保护。Vue.js的中心库只重视视图层,易于上手,一起也能够与其它库或已有项目无缝集成。

1. 进步开发功率:Vue.js供给了丰厚的组件库和指令,使得开发者能够快速构建杂乱的用户界面。经过组件化开发,Vue.js将大型运用拆分红多个可复用的组件,降低了代码的杂乱度,进步了开发功率。

2. 双向数据绑定:Vue.js的中心特性之一是双向数据绑定。它答应开发者经过简略的语法完成数据与视图的同步更新,减少了手动操作DOM的次数,降低了犯错概率。

3. 呼应式体系:Vue.js的呼应式体系能够主动追寻依靠联系,当数据发生变化时,视图会主动更新。这使得开发者能够专心于事务逻辑,而不用忧虑DOM操作,进步了开发功率。

4. 组件化开发:Vue.js的组件化开发形式使得代码愈加模块化、可复用。开发者能够将杂乱的界面拆分红多个组件,便于办理和保护。

5. 路由办理:Vue.js集成了Vue Router,能够便利地完成单页面运用(SPA)的路由办理。开发者能够轻松完成页面跳转、参数传递等功用。

6. 状况办理:Vue.js集成了Vuex,能够便利地完成大局状况办理。开发者能够会集办理运用的状况,使得组件之间的通讯愈加简略。

1. 构建单页面运用(SPA):Vue.js十分合适构建SPA,由于它能够快速烘托页面,进步用户体会。许多盛行的运用,如饿了么、网易云音乐等,都是根据Vue.js开发的。

2. 企业级运用开发:Vue.js的组件化开发形式、呼应式体系和状况办理功用,使得它十分合适企业级运用开发。许多大型企业,如阿里巴巴、腾讯等,都在运用Vue.js进行项目开发。

3. 移动端开发:Vue.js的轻量级和呼应式特性,使得它十分合适移动端开发。开发者能够运用Vue.js快速构建高功能的移动端运用。

4. 跨渠道开发:Vue.js能够经过Weex、uni-app等技能完成跨渠道开发,使得开发者能够一起开发Web、iOS和Android运用。

1. 功能优化:Vue.js将持续优化功能,进步运用的呼应速度和加载速度。

2. 生态建设:Vue.js将持续完善其生态体系,供给更多优异的库和东西,便利开发者进行开发。

3. 国际化:Vue.js将支撑更多言语,便利全球开发者运用。

4. 与新技能交融:Vue.js将与其他新技能,如人工智能、区块链等,进行交融,拓宽其运用场景。

Vue.js作为一款现代前端开发结构,具有许多优势。它不只进步了开发功率,还降低了代码杂乱度,使得开发者能够愈加专心于事务逻辑。跟着Vue.js的不断发展,信任它将在前端开发范畴发挥越来越重要的效果。

猜你喜欢

  • jquery用法, 什么是 jQuery?前端开发

    jquery用法, 什么是 jQuery?

    jQuery是一个快速、小型且功用丰厚的JavaScript库。它使HTML文档的遍历和操作、工作处理、动画和Ajax交互变得愈加简略。以下是jQuery的一些根本用法:1.引进jQuery库:在HTML文档中引...

    2025-01-08 0
  • vue完成拖拽,vue完成拖拽功用前端开发

    vue完成拖拽,vue完成拖拽功用

    在Vue中完成拖拽功用一般涉及到监听鼠标事情,如`mousedown`,`mousemove`,和`mouseup`,以及或许需求`dragstart`,`drag`,`dragend`等事情。以下是一个简略的示例,展现了如安在V...

    2025-01-08 1
  • html页面布景,HTML 布景布景色彩设置为浅蓝色。前端开发

    html页面布景,HTML 布景布景色彩设置为浅蓝色。

    HTML页面的布景能够经过CSS样式表来设置。下面是一些常见的设置布景的办法:1.运用`backgroundcolor`特点设置布景色彩:```htmlbody{backgroundcolor:lightblue;}HTML布景...

    2025-01-08 0
  • html色彩标签,html色彩代码表大全前端开发

    html色彩标签,html色彩代码表大全

    1.色彩称号:HTML支撑大约140种色彩称号,如赤色、蓝色、绿色等。例如:```html这是赤色文本。```2.十六进制色彩代码:十六进制色彩代码是一个由井号()后跟六个十六进制数字(09和AF)组成的字...

    2025-01-08 0
  • vue的路由前端开发

    vue的路由

    Vue.js是一个用于构建用户界面的渐进式JavaScript结构。它被规划为能够自底向上逐层运用。Vue的中心库只重视视图层,不只易于上手,还便于与第三方库或既有项目整合。在Vue中,路由一般指的是前端路由,它答运用户在不改写页...

    2025-01-08 1
  • css增加图片,css怎样增加图片前端开发

    css增加图片,css怎样增加图片

    运用`backgroundimage`特点假如您想将图片作为布景增加到某个元素上,能够运用`backgroundimage`特点。例如,将图片设置为元素的布景:```css.element{width:200px;he...

    2025-01-08 1
  • vue循环, Vue.js 循环烘托原理前端开发

    vue循环, Vue.js 循环烘托原理

    在Vue中,循环通常是经过`vfor`指令完成的。`vfor`指令能够用来遍历数组、目标、数字规模等,并在每次迭代中烘托模板。根本用法```html{{item.name}}...

    2025-01-08 2
  • 怎样把html转化成pdf, HTML内容html_content =     Example PDF    Hello, World!    This is an example PDF generated from HTML.前端开发

    怎样把html转化成pdf, HTML内容html_content = Example PDF Hello, World! This is an example PDF generated from HTML.

    将HTML转化为PDF一般涉及到将网页上的内容渲染成PDF格局的文件。这能够经过多种办法完结,包含运用在线东西、桌面软件或编程库。以下是几种常见的办法:1.在线东西有许多在线东西能够将HTML转化为PDF。你只需将HTML代码或网页UR...

    2025-01-08 1